The compound is directly compositional: 'crimping' (the action of pressing edges together) modifies 'pliers' (a gripping tool), so the phrase means 'pliers used for crimping'. This follows a common English pattern (verb+ing + tool) and is cross-linguistically transparent, so a B1 learner who knows the constituent words will readily infer the meaning.
Etymology
Crimping pliers comes from the tool's action: to crimp is to press and fold metal so it will 'hold' another piece, and pliers are a hand tool for gripping. So crimping pliers are pliers used to make that 'crimp', which is why they are used to 'join' or secure connectors to wires.
